The Fibonacci sequence leads to the golden ratio. The sequence is given by starting with 0 and adding the next number to the previous. The sequence then is 0,1,1,2,3,5,8,13,21,34….When you divide the larger digit by the former smaller digit, it approximates 1.618…the golden ratio or Phi as the ancient Greeks called it.
